Consultation and model selection
A good smart thermostat installation begins with model selection based on your equipment and goals. During a consultation we:
- Confirm HVAC type: single-stage, multi-stage, heat pump, or dual fuel and note any zoning, ECM blowers, or communicating systems.
- Evaluate wiring at the existing thermostat for necessary control wires such as C, O/B, W2, Y2, G, and dedicated communications.
- Discuss desired features: geofencing, remote sensors, adaptive learning, energy reports, and voice assistant compatibility.
- Recommend models and accessory options that are fully compatible with your Tempe home and deliver the expected savings and features.
Professional installation and Wi-Fi setup
Proper installation goes beyond swapping devices. Professional services include:
- Verifying system compatibility and installing required interface modules or common wire adaptors when needed.
- Mounting the thermostat in an optimal location away from direct sunlight, drafts, and heat sources to ensure accurate temperature sensing.
- Completing secure Wi-Fi setup and account configuration while testing cloud connectivity and app controls.
- Ensuring wiring is labeled and left tidy for future troubleshooting.
- Testing system response through full cooling and heating cycles and confirming proper staging and fan behavior.
Programming for energy savings and comfort
Smart thermostats can be powerful energy tools when programmed correctly:
- Customized schedules: set cooling setpoints for occupied and unoccupied periods and adjust for weekday/weekend habits.
- Temperature setback strategies for daytime and overnight that respect comfort thresholds but reduce run time during peak heat.
- Integration with occupancy sensing or geofencing to automatically adjust when the last person leaves Tempe homes.
- Humidity-aware routines during monsoon season to keep indoor humidity balanced without overcooling.
- Adaptive algorithms that learn how your specific HVAC responds to Tempe’s heat and optimize start/stop times for consistent comfort.

Expected energy benefits in Tempe
- Realistic energy savings depend on home occupancy, thermostat habits, and HVAC efficiency, but many Tempe homes see 8 to 15 percent savings in cooling expenses after proper installation and programming.
- Savings are typically higher when combined with minor behavior changes like modestly higher cooling setpoints during peak afternoon hours and leveraging smart scheduling.
- For homes with older, inefficient equipment, a smart thermostat improves comfort but will not substitute for inefficiencies; pairing a smart thermostat with regular maintenance increases overall gains.
Maintenance, upgrades, and best practices
- Annual HVAC tune-ups paired with thermostat review keep system communications and schedules aligned with seasonal needs.
- Consider adding remote temperature sensors for rooms prone to heat gain, such as west-facing living spaces or sunrooms common in Tempe houses.
- If Wi-Fi is weak in thermostat locations, place a dedicated extender or choose thermostats that support reliable local control and robust cloud connectivity.
- Reassess scheduling and humidity control with season changes and occupancy patterns to sustain energy benefits year-round.
